Dragon TigerTwo-card format
The dealer deals one card to the Dragon position and one to the Tiger position. Whichever hand has the higher card wins. Ties pay at a separate rate. Dragon Tiger rounds complete in under a minute, making it one of the fastest Macau Pools variants we offer.

Sic BoThree-dice format
Three dice roll in a cage or tumbler. You predict the outcome: specific numbers, total sum, or patterns. Sic Bo offers more outcome combinations than Dragon Tiger, so payouts vary by bet type. Each round takes roughly two to three minutes.

Live Roulette (Macau Format)Wheel-based format
A traditional roulette wheel spins with a ball that settles on a numbered pocket. Macau-format roulette on wordl often features custom betting zones and side bets. Rounds last around three to five minutes depending on table settings.
